ABOUT
Re|shelter is a non-profit, charitable 501(c)3 corporation founded to address the urgent need for housing alternatives for people with environmental sensitivities.
Our vision: to transform the homes, health & lives of people with environmental intolerances through renovation grants and the construction of non-toxic housing and healing communities.
Our mission: Re|shelter is a charitable 501(c)3 organization committed to addressing the current housing crisis and high rates of homelessness and suicide within vulnerable populations affected by disabling environmental sensitivities. Our activities include fundraising, awarding housing aid grants, facilitating the design and construction of healthy homes and communities, and using the arts to promote awareness.
Our planned projects:
FUNDRAISING/GRANTS
• Arts Education & Fundraising using the arts to raise awareness and funds
• Fundraising/Grantwriting Effort raising funds so that we may bring our projects to fruition
• Grant Programs awarding small Renovation Grants to create safe rooms within an existing home, apartment or trailer for eligible individuals and larger Housing Aid Grants to help eligible individuals purchase homes or trailers
• Re|shelter Auction now accepting tax-deductible donations of safer goods and services
SAFER HOUSING SEARCH
• MCSsafehomes.com providing a stand-alone website with up-to-date safer housing ads and resources
• Re|shelter Underground Network (RUN) facilitating emergency housing placement for those in desperate situations through a global e-mail network
DESIGN/CONSTRUCTION
• Trailer Prototypes collaborating with others to produce DIY trailer plans and material specifications
POLICY CHANGE
• Scent Free Public Restrooms urging government agencies to institute updated indoor air quality policies for public restrooms on highways and in state and national campgrounds
OTHER
• Volunteer Program working with volunteers to achieve our mission
